The word “twin” comes from the Latin word “gemini,” meaning “twins.” Twins are the result of a woman releasing two eggs at the same time during ovulation or when a single egg splits in two during the fertilization process. Most twins are fraternal, meaning they are developed from two separate eggs, while about one-third of twins are identical, meaning they are developed from a single egg that splits in two.
